Compact Power: The Gas Insulated Substation Market

Industry analysis highlights that the Gas Insulated Substation Market is growing steadily as utilities seek compact, reliable solutions for power transmission and distribution. Gas insulated substations (GIS) use sulfur hexafluoride (SF6) or alternative gases to insulate high-voltage components, enabling significant footprint reduction compared to air-insulated substations (AIS). This makes GIS ideal for urban areas, underground facilities, and space-constrained sites. As grids expand and land becomes scarce, demand for GIS continues to rise.

The primary driver of the market is the need for compact, reliable substations in dense urban environments. GIS occupies 10-25% of the space required for equivalent AIS, making it essential where land is limited or expensive. GIS also offers higher reliability, as encapsulated components are protected from environmental contamination. This reduces maintenance and improves availability.

Technologically, the market encompasses several voltage classes, from medium voltage to ultra-high voltage. SF6 remains the dominant insulating gas, though alternatives such as g3 and C4F7N are emerging due to SF6’s high global warming potential. Hybrid switchgear combines GIS and AIS advantages, offering flexibility.

The market is segmented by voltage class, installation type, and region. Voltage classes include medium, high, and ultra-high voltage. Installation types include indoor and outdoor. Regions vary in adoption, with Asia-Pacific leading due to urbanization, followed by Europe and North America.

Key trends include the adoption of SF6-free technologies, driven by environmental regulations. Digital monitoring and condition assessment are improving reliability. Modular and prefabricated designs are reducing installation time.

Challenges include high capital costs and SF6 environmental concerns. Regulatory compliance adds complexity. Skilled workforce shortages can constrain deployment.

The future outlook is positive, with growth driven by urbanization, grid modernization, and environmental regulations. GIS will remain essential to power distribution, and advances in SF6-free technologies and digital monitoring will shape the market.
